Match report: Burnley 0-0 Arsenal
WHAT HAPPENED The first goalless draw of the Mikel Arteta era, but this was a tale of big chances squandered at both ends. Burnley had more than their fair share of those, but it probably would have been a comfortable afternoon for us if our two most experienced strikers hadn't uncharacteristically squandered early opportunities. Alex Lacazette nodded wide when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ang's cross found him completely free six yards out. And the captain himself got it wrong when put through by David Luiz's ball over the top.
